Christa McAuliffe was born in 1948 and she was an astronaut almost by accident.In 1984,NASA decided  to find a teacher who could accompany astronauts into space.They hoped that she would be able to     communicate with students from space.Christa was a secondary school teacher in history and social studies and she was selected from over 11,000 applicants to go on flight STS-51-L.Thousands of students in schools and universities all around the country were looking forward to communicating with Christa in space.Millions of people were watching her flight with great interest.

But Judy was very different.She was born in 1949 and studied engineering at university and went on to  obtain a Ph.D in 1977.She was a member of the first group of women selected for astronaut training in  1978,and in 1984,she became the second woman into space.During that flight,she helped to launch three new satellites and she carried out a program of research.She was a professional astronaut.
